Editors: Chaki, R., Cortesi, A., Saeed, K., Chaki, N. (Eds.) Discusses recent research trends in areas of computational intelligence, communications, data mining and computational models Presents applications to provide design, analysis, and model for key areas in computational intelligence Discusses efficient computational algorithms and vigorous tools for efficient implementation The book contains the extended version of the works that have been presented and discussed in the Second International Doctoral Symposium on Applied Computation and Security Systems (ACSS 2015) held during May 23-25, 2015 in Kolkata, India. The symposium has been jointly organized by the AGH University of Science & Technology, Cracow, Poland Ca Foscari University, Venice, Italy and University of Calcutta, India. The book is divided into volumes and presents dissertation works in the areas of Image Processing, Biometrics-based Authentication, Soft Computing, Data Mining, Next Generation Networking and Network Security, Remote Healthcare, Communications, Embedded Systems, Software Engineering and Service Engineering.
